Traffic data products are used in safety evaluation, pavement design, funding decisions, forecasting, modeling, and much more. This information is used to produce volume, classification, speed and weight data as well as traffic forecasts, vehicle miles traveled (VMT) figures, reports, maps and analysis. Thousands of traffic counts are collected on Minnesota roadways each year. Traffic Forecasting & Analysis Traffic congestion on a Minnesota highway
